Quick heads-up for reviewers: the bounce processor in Mailwren chews through the dead-letter queue every ten minutes, classifying hard vs. soft bounces and updating suppression lists. If it wedges (usually a malformed MIME header), just restart the worker — state is idempotent, so reprocessing is safe. One gotcha: the worker authenticates to the suppression store at startup, and that credential lives in the env file, not in config. When you rebuild the file from the template, append the auth line right here.

sealed setting: RELAY_SECRET5=82864

## 3.1.4 — Rotated audio bundle signing key

Quick one for review: we swapped out the signing key for Murmur, the audio-guide app used at the Helvard Gallery pilot. The old key dated back to the prototype days and was shared across too many build machines, so we retired it. Exhibit audio bundles signed after this release use the new key; older bundles re-verify on next sync, no action needed from curators. For reviewing the pipeline change, check signatures against the key below.

rollout seal: bky4_yke3

## Runbook: Tallow API Circuit Breaker

Breaker fronts all calls from Marrowline to the upstream Tallow API. Open state returns fast 503s; half-open probes every interval. If stuck open past ten minutes, check upstream health before forcing close. Never disable during release windows. Changes require release-manager sign-off. Current production breaker configuration follows below.

deployment values, bafog-tajop:
NOVAEL_PIN=7103
NOVAEL_TENANT=weneth
NOVAEL_METRICS_HOST=metrics.novael.crelvocorp.corp
NOVAEL_SEAL=seal_be72a3d3
NOVAEL_STANDBY_TEAM=caseth

Facilities ticket — Halewick Tower, night shift.

Issue: support team reporting east stairwell reader rejecting badges after midnight. Reader was reset this morning; firmware updated. Overnight crew should now badge as normal. If the reader fails again, use the manual keypad by the fire door — do not prop the door. Log any further failures with the time and badge name. Temporary keypad code for the fallback door is below.

door code, tajeg-fawip: bdg-K-62